One of the key skills required for a career in security is attention to detail. Security professionals must be able to identify potential threats and vulnerabilities to ensure the safety of individuals and properties. Additionally, strong communication and problem-solving skills are essential for effectively managing security incidents and collaborating with colleagues.
To start a career in cybersecurity, individuals can pursue relevant certifications, such as Certified Information Systems Security Professional (CISSP) or Certified Ethical Hacker (CEH). Additionally, gaining hands-on experience through internships or entry-level positions can help individuals build a strong foundation in cybersecurity and increase their employability.
The security field offers numerous opportunities for advancement, including roles such as security manager, security consultant, or chief security officer. By continuously expanding their skills and knowledge, security professionals can progress in their careers and take on leadership positions within organizations. Additionally, pursuing advanced certifications and higher education can enhance career prospects in the security field.
